Computer Land Australia Pty Ltd
283 Charman Rd 3192 Cheltenham Victoria Australia
- Profile: Computer Land Australia Pty Ltd is a Computer Equipment - Hardware Home Office company located at Cheltenham, Victoria Australia, address is 283 Charman Rd, Cheltenham 3192 VIC, postcode is 3192, you can contact Computer Land Australia Pty Ltd by phone 1300666755